Grant Description

In August 2007, the Chinese Government donated 30,000 tons of rice to Guinea-Bissau to help address urgent food shortages in the country.

This large-scale donation followed an earlier shipment of 2,000 tons of rice (date unknown) that had temporarily alleviated immediate needs while the larger consignment was arranged. The August 2007 donation was critical in stabilizing food availability and preventing potential civil unrest.
